Abramelin Posted December 17, 2012 #55 Share Posted December 17, 2012 That this bat looks extremely huge is because of perspective. The guy you see on his back is right under the bat. If you look closely, you can see they stuck a cigaret in the mouth of the bat. However, golden crowned flying foxes are large critters: they have a wingspan of 6 feet and sometimes more. 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
